Visitors peg back Town at PPG Canalside

Town’s Under-18s couldn’t secure all three points in the latest Professional Development League 2 game of the season at PPG Canalside on Saturday morning, despite taking a two goal lead against visitors Coventry City.

Midfielder Adam Porritt (pictured) gave Tony Carss’s side the lead going into the interval and things looked good when Irish striker Ronan Coughlan doubled the advantage in the 65th minute, but the visitors fought back hard to take a point from the game. 

Despite not holding onto its lead, Town’s Under-18 side is now six games unbeaten and has won six and drawn two of its last nine games.

Town’s team (4-2-3-1):
Tadhg Ryan; Jack Senior, Nathaniel Pells, Jacob Hanson, Brad Carroll (c); Regan Booty, Jamie Spencer; Jack Boyle (Sam Warde, 85), Ronan Coughlan, Adam Porritt (Dylan Cogill, 90); Rekeil Pyke

Unused Substitutes:
Owen Brooke, Lewis O’Brien, Harry Clibbens
